Ensure Regular Cleaning

Regularly, clean the lab’s furniture. Clean the counters, storage cabinets, benches, desks, and chairs when the experiments are completed. Cleaning removes dust and prevents undesirable substances from contaminating your valuable furniture. Also, the furnishings will remain  clean and sterile for use  the following day 

Use mild cleaning agents and dry cloth

To remove tough stains, grease, and loose debris use a mild detergent that is widely available in supermarkets. Harsh chemicals will swiftly remove the stains but they will damage the surfaces of lab furniture. By utilizing gentle cleaning products you can avoid this. After cleaning the furniture, wipe it off with a dry cloth. A microfiber cloth or chamois cloth works well.

Avoid overloading

Remember that the cabinet storages, shelves, and drawers have a specified weight-bearing capacity. Don’t disregard this by storing heavy-duty equipment and other stuff in big quantities. Overloading can cause structural damage and reduce the longevity of furniture..Instead, keep equipment and other items in designated places. Furthermore, you can add more shelves and drawers as needed.

Routine Inspection

Examine the furnishings for signs of wear and tear. Look for any loose pieces that require immediate care. If necessary, have the parts fixed. Lubricating agents should be used on moving parts to ensure their durability.

Types of Storage Cabinets

Base Cabinets

A base cabinet is installed and /or placed on the floor. Face frames, doors, and drawer fronts on base cabinets are made of solid hardwood. These cabinets are typically 24″deep but the width varies depending on user preferences. The primary purpose of the base cabinet is to provide structural support for counters and other surfaces. They provide storage space in the form of drawers or shelves. Many kinds of chemicals and materials can be stored within them which can be easily accessed by lab workers without straining them.

Mobile Cabinets

Mobile storage cabinets are base cabinets fixed with four wheels to facilitate a smooth transition of items from one location to another. These cabinets are composed of stainless steel and can survive years of heavy use. They are available in a range of colors to enrich the appearance of the surroundings. Drawers and shelves can be configured to meet customer preferences. Visual security is installed on the doors to safeguard valuable and sensitive items against theft.

Wall Cabinets

Wall storage cabinets are always installed on vertical surfaces like walls, a divider,  panels, and certain other vertical structures. A wall cabinet is usually less than 48″high to avoid straining the user. These cabinets are constructed using fiberboard of medium density, plywood, or stainless steel. They are available with open fronts, hinged doors, or sliding doors. The shelves can be configured to meet customer preferences.

Suspended Cabinets

Suspended cabinets are mechanically suspended from a table frame or rail system. These cabinets are simple to remove and relocate. These cabinets touch the wall and wall studs support the weight. The doors and drawers can be configured. The doors can have locks to safeguard items.

Tall Cabinets

Tall cabinets are placed on the floor and are usually 84″high. Tall cabinets are often called pantry cabinets or utility cabinets. They can be configured with doors and adjustable shelves to match the needs of the customer. The tall dimensions lend a  grand appearance to any background. Tall cabinets can store many items within them.

Counter Mounted Cabinets

A counter-mounted cabinet is a wall cabinet that is attached to a worktop or shelf. The counter-mounted cabinets are typically 48″.tall.These cabinets can be configured with multiple shelves and lockable doors.

Laboratory Countertops

Lab countertops serve as a work surface to carry out all kinds of research and experiments. They are pedestals built to withstand harsh working conditions. 

Read Also: Different Types of Modern Laboratory Furniture

Materials Used in Laboratory Countertops

Phenolic Resin

Phenolic Resins countertops are robust and lightweight manufactured by layering Kraft papers saturated with Phenolic Resin and treated at high temperatures. They have excellent chemical and moisture resistance. The material doesn’t support the growth of any kind of bacteria or fungus. Can withstand heat temperatures up to 350° F. They are ideal for chemical, biological, clinical, and Analytical labs. The only drawback is that they are not flame-retardant.

Epoxy Resin

Epoxy Resin countertops are constructed of heavy-duty materials. They are resistant to harsh chemicals, water and moisture.No culture of fungi or bacteria can grow on them. So they guarantee a sterile workspace. Can withstand heat temperatures up to 350° F. They are flame retardant. They are ideal for Hospitals, Industrial testing,  and Chemical labs. 

High-Pressure Laminate

High-Pressuressure Laminate countertops are very appealing.s.They are durable and affordable. Can withstand temperatures of up to 275° F. They are recommended only for chemical-free and dry applications. The downsides are limited resistance to chemicals.. Not Fungal resistant. Can’t endure the harsh work atmosphere.

ESD Laminate

ESD Laminate countertops are constructed of high-pressure laminate with a carbon layer to dissipate static charge. They offer resistance to stains and chemicals. Custom-made shelves and accessories are available.ESD Laminate is ideal for use in workstations and labs where materials are sensitive to static and needs protection. The downside is that it is not resistant to moisture. Deep scratches cannot be fixed.

Stainless Steel

Stainless steel countertops are low-carbon steel which has a chromium and steel blend. They offer resistance to moisture and chemicals. and don’t rust. Bacteria and other germs can’t grow on them. Constant tolerance to heat exposure above 1500°F. Hospitals, pharmaceutical labs, clean rooms,  and food testing which handle high temperatures and need sterile processing employ steel countertops. However, they are expensive.
